    Red Sox disappoint in Game 2, lose 9-2

    Opener Alec Gamboa departed in the second inning, yielding to Brayan Bello with a runner on first. The Sox used the same template as the earlier contest today: score early with a solo homer. This time it was Nick Sogard in the top of the third, notching his third hit in his last four at-bats.

    Unfortunately, Bello let things get away from him in the third. Three hits, a walk, a hit batsman, a sac fly, stolen base and an error later, the Yankees had plated three (all earned). Bello followed with a nine-pitch fourth inning and a similarly 1-2-3 fifth, making it look easy again, and giving the offense time to chip away at the deficit.

    In the sixth, the Sox tried to do just that, starting off with a walk and a HBP and no outs. They forced another pitching change too but then quickly ended the inning, with a sequence that included two K’s in a row. So much for that rally.

    The sixth was also rocky for Bello, with two Yankee singles and a double steal. After a sac fly that scored a run, Chad Tracy had seen enough. Raymond Burgos, freshly back in the bigs, got the Sox out of the inning.

    Meanwhile, things were real quiet at the dish between Sogard’s third-inning homer and Abreu’s eighth-inning double. That double seemed to light a fire under them, as Willson Contreras followed it with a triple…but he was stranded there.

    In the bottom of the eighth, there was an embarrassing defensive moment when a pop fly dropped between Sogard and Abreu. Then another when Burgos didn’t cover first base, allowing the bases to fill because Contreras, who’d fielded the ground ball, had nowhere to throw. Several runs scored on single after single after single [blah blah let’s not dwell on it too much], then the bases loaded for the second time in the inning. The Yankees batted around, sending Bellinger to the plate twice in the eighth. They scored five times in the inning, all on singles, all on Burgos.

    On the night, every spot in the batting order scored a run.

    Not our night at all. The Yankees evened up the season series again with the split of the doubleheader.
